Given below are the two processes of Direct Entry route at Intermediate level to pursue Chartered Accountancy course from ICAI:
Eligible Graduates and Postgraduates
Register with the BOS for the Intermediate course.
Successfully complete the four-week ICITSS before the commencement of the Practical Training.
Register for the three-year Practical Training.
Appear in CA Intermediate examination after nine months of Practical Training.
Qualify CA Intermediate level.
Register for the CA Final Course after qualifying both groups of the Intermediate course.
Successfully complete four-week AICITSS during the last two years of practical training but before appearing for CA Final examination.
Appear in CA Final examination during last six months of Practical Training.
Complete Practical Training.
Qualify both groups of CA Final.
Become a member of the ICAI.
